About Contentstack MCP Server
Empower your conversational AI with secure and instant read access to your Contentstack headless CMS. Utilizing the Contentstack Delivery API, your agent can efficiently fetch published entries, retrieve asset URLs, and audit content type schema structures in real-time.

Contentstack MCP Tools for OpenAI Agents SDK (9)
These 9 tools become available when you connect Contentstack to OpenAI Agents SDK via MCP:
get_asset_details
Get details for a specific asset
get_content_type_details
Get the schema for a specific content type
get_entry
Get detailed content for a specific entry
get_stack_summary
Get high-level metadata about the current stack
list_assets
List all published assets
list_content_types
List all content types in the stack
list_entries
List published entries for a specific content type
search_entries
Search for entries using a JSON query
sync_content
Retrieve delta of changes since last sync
